Python全栈之MySQL数据库介绍

2025-01-15 01:43:20   小编

Python全栈之MySQL数据库介绍

在Python全栈开发的领域中,MySQL数据库扮演着至关重要的角色。它作为一种关系型数据库管理系统,以其高效、可靠和开源的特性,成为众多开发者的首选。

MySQL数据库具有高度的灵活性和可扩展性。无论是小型的个人项目,还是大型的企业级应用,MySQL都能提供强大的数据存储和管理支持。其开源的性质使得开发者无需支付高昂的软件授权费用,降低了开发成本。这对于初创企业和开源项目来说,无疑是一大优势。

在数据处理能力方面,MySQL表现卓越。它能够快速地执行各种数据库操作,如数据的插入、查询、更新和删除。通过优化的查询算法和索引机制,MySQL可以在海量数据中迅速定位和提取所需信息,极大地提高了应用程序的响应速度。

MySQL的另一大亮点是其良好的兼容性。它可以与多种操作系统和编程语言无缝集成,Python便是其中之一。通过Python的数据库接口,如pymysql库,开发者可以方便地连接到MySQL数据库,并进行各种操作。这种紧密的集成使得Python全栈开发者能够轻松地将数据库功能融入到自己的应用程序中,实现数据的持久化存储和高效管理。

在数据安全性方面,MySQL提供了一系列的安全机制。用户可以设置不同的权限,对数据库的访问进行严格控制,确保数据的保密性和完整性。MySQL还支持数据备份和恢复功能,以应对可能出现的数据丢失或损坏情况。

MySQL拥有庞大的社区支持。这意味着开发者在遇到问题时,能够迅速从社区中获取解决方案和技术支持。丰富的文档资源也为初学者提供了便利,帮助他们快速掌握MySQL的使用方法。

MySQL数据库在Python全栈开发中占据着不可替代的地位。其高效性、可扩展性、兼容性和安全性,为开发者提供了一个强大的数据管理平台,助力他们打造出更加优质、可靠的应用程序。

TAGS: 数据库应用 MySQL数据库 MySQL特性 Python全栈

欢迎使用万千站长工具!

Welcome to www.zzTool.com